Responsible for the tax payables function which includes remitting timely payments to state departments and reconciliation of accounts.
Surplus Lines Tax Specialist Job Profile Summary The Surplus Lines Tax Specialist supports the accurate and timely processing, reconciliation, and compliance of surplus lines tax filings across multiple jurisdictions. In this role, you will help ensure filing data is complete, submissions meet state requirements, and records are maintained with a high level of accuracy. Working under general supervision, you will partner with internal teams, resolve routine to moderately complex issues, and contribute to process improvements that support efficiency, compliance, and strong business outcomes.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:- Prepare, review, and support surplus lines tax documentation and reporting requirements across multiple states.
- Monitor filing deadlines and help ensure submissions align with applicable state surplus lines tax regulations.
- Reconcile tax payments, maintain accurate records, and research or resolve discrepancies in a timely manner.
- Partner with internal teams to gather data, validate policy information, and support accurate filings.
- Assist with research related to regulatory updates and help maintain internal procedures as requirements change.
- Support audits by organizing documentation, responding to inquiries, and providing accurate records when needed.
- Maintain organized tax-related files and records to support easy retrieval, review, and inspection.
- Identify opportunities to improve processes, strengthen accuracy, and create greater efficiency in day-to-day work.
